sunday i had the pleasure of accompanying my youngest daughter to the mutter museum at the college of physicians of philadelphia. it's a museum dedicated to medical oddities, actual specimens as well as reproductions. they also have a large display of medical instruments used throughout history and many other interesting things.
there is information and a lot of images on their website, but only take a look if you have a strong stomach, are a medical doctor or enjoy experiencing medical oddities at their finest. it was definitely "disturbingly informative". we may have to go back for the next exhibit, a collection of shrunken heads from south america.
